Understanding the Transformation

Rich Wilson, CEO of Gigged.AI, envisions a future where AI enhances human talent rather than replaces it. His platform connects freelancers with businesses, aiming to revolutionize how companies manage talent and deliver value. Wilson believes that AI will redefine core business operations over the next decade, shifting from traditional hiring practices to a more dynamic, skills-based model. This transformation is not only about automation but also about creating smarter, more efficient processes that benefit both employers and employees.

Key Insights

  • AI will enable faster talent matching by focusing on skills rather than job descriptions.
  • Companies can scale with fewer full-time hires, relying more on freelancers and AI systems.
  • Gigged.AI has reduced recruitment times from weeks to hours, significantly cutting costs.
  • Ethical considerations, like bias in algorithms and data security, are prioritized to ensure fairness in talent selection.

The Bigger Picture

The integration of AI into business models is set to redefine the workplace. Wilson emphasizes that AI will not replace human jobs but will enhance them, allowing workers to focus on strategic and creative tasks. This collaboration between humans and AI will foster innovation and productivity. As AI continues to evolve, customer experiences will also improve, leading to more personalized interactions and informed decision-making. The future of work is about synergy, where technology and human creativity coexist to drive business success.
